This was a short, annoying, predictable but mildly heartpounding listen.
Obvious clues were obvious and there really needed to be a better resolution.
The plot raised questions it didn't answer, a writing issue that I find annoying, even in short stories where in detailed epilogues are generally unconventional.
Overall, though, this is one I'd recommend to anyone in the mood for a quick, if familiar, thrill ride. Three stars.
